1. Diversification
Diversification is one of the most important principles of investing. By diversifying your portfolio, you are spreading your risk across different assets, which reduces the impact of any one asset on your overall portfolio. Adding gold to your IRA is an excellent way to diversify your portfolio. Gold has a low correlation with other assets like stocks and bonds, which means that it can provide a hedge against market volatility.
2. Inflation Protection
Inflation can erode the value of your investments over time. As the cost of living increases, the purchasing power of your money decreases. One of the advantages of gold is that it can act as a hedge against inflation. Gold has a long history of maintaining its value in times of high inflation. When the value of the dollar declines, the price of gold tends to rise.

4. Portfolio Protection
Gold is a safe-haven asset that can provide protection to your portfolio during times of economic uncertainty. When the economy is in turmoil, investors tend to flock to safe-haven assets like gold. This can cause the price of gold to rise, which can help protect your portfolio from market volatility.
5. Easy to Add to Your IRA
Adding gold to your IRA is easy. You can purchase gold bullion or coins and have them transferred directly to your IRA custodian. Alternatively, you can invest in gold ETFs or mutual funds that hold physical gold. This makes it easy for investors to add gold to their IRA without having to worry about storage or security.
